Roses all the way Health Auured by Perfect Teeth Life is "roses, roses all the way" when the teeth are sound and healthy. For health and high-spirits depend on sound teeth. One out of every five users of any dental preparation in the British Isles uses Gibbs Dentifrice. What is the reason for this overwhelming preference? The fragrant foam from its saponaceous base searches every crevice and interstice of the teeth. Gibbs Dentifrice contains no acid to injure the delicate membranes of the mouth and gums. It destroys the germs of decay, even where the brush cannot reach. Its polishing agent is calcium carbonate —softer than the enamel. Gently but thoroughly it polishes the light facets of the enamel, revealing their glorious lustre. Adopt this golden rule of lasting health in your household. Use Gibbs Dentifrice twice a day.
